First, it’s helpful to understand what defines an assisted living apartment. Unlike a nursing home, these are typically private or semi-private residences within a community that provides personal care support, meals, housekeeping, and social activities. The goal is to offer help with daily tasks like bathing, dressing, or medication management while maximizing independence. In a smaller community like Farmersville, this often means a more intimate setting where staff and residents genuinely know one another, which can be a tremendous comfort.
As you explore options locally and in the broader Montgomery County area, consider the specific needs of your family member. Make a list of the daily activities where they require assistance. This list will become your most valuable tool when touring communities and speaking with directors. Ask detailed questions about staff training, caregiver-to-resident ratios, and how care plans are created and updated. Observe how staff interact with current residents—are they patient, respectful, and engaged? The atmosphere during a midday visit can tell you a great deal about the daily life within those walls.
For families in Farmersville, considering the local context is also wise. Think about proximity. Having an assisted living apartment close by in Litchfield, Hillsboro, or even Springfield means you can visit frequently, which is vital for your loved one’s emotional well-being and your own peace of mind. Consider the community’s ability to handle our Central Illinois weather—are walkways well-maintained in winter? Are there secure, accessible indoor common areas for socializing when it’s too hot or cold to go out? Also, inquire about transportation services for medical appointments in larger nearby cities, as this is a common need.
Finally, trust your instincts during visits. Notice if the apartments feel like a home. Are there spaces for personal belongings and familiar furniture? Look at the activity calendar—does it include a mix of social events, gentle exercise, and perhaps local outings that connect residents to the wider community? The financial aspect is, of course, critical. Be sure to have transparent conversations about all costs, what is included in the base fee, and what incurs additional charges.
